Southside School was built in 1956 to educate the students from Kindergarten to Grade 5 who lived in the south-west corner of Woodstock, Ontario. At the present time, the school welcomes 393 students from Full-Day Kindergarten to Grade 8. An addition was completed in 2018.
Southside Public School is the home of the Tigers.
